Transaction 1dab1e650bb2fe7a9828ac6e2ed3f22f2f250a0d48a96f2f9932db89eb9c6147
1 Input
1 Output
-
1dab1e650bb2fe7a9828ac6e2ed3f22f2f250a0d48a96f2f9932db89eb9c6147:0
- value
- 1576042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d80c0bd61a371dc1ec769302efe93cd765e5008 OP_EQUAL
- address
- 3EbDSVvR5i2mmhuaoLE6jyzAJkXCYKwe1f